Fish contributes 60 percent of animal protein intake of Ghanaians. About 75 percent of the total domestic production of fish is consumed locally. The fishing industry in Ghana is based on resources from the marine and inland (freshwater) sectors, coastal lagoons and aquaculture (Quaatey, 1997; NAFAG, 2007). 3. how many people have hashimoto\u0027s thyroiditis https://gftcourses.com

Web6 sep. 2024 · In Ghana and many other African countries, it has generally been a serious problem. There are many causes of river pollution which includes illegal mining activities, dumping of refuse in the rivers, the use of DDT to fish among others. Illegal mining activities are one of the very major causes as far as river pollution is concerned.
